#EC864E Hex Color Code

#EC864E

The Hexadecimal Color #EC864E is a contrast shade of Coral. #EC864E RGB value is rgb(236, 134, 78). RGB Color Model of #EC864E consists of 92% red, 52% green and 30% blue. HSL color Mode of #EC864E has 21°(degrees) Hue, 81% Saturation and 62% Lightness. #EC864E color has an wavelength of 606.77778n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#EC864E is #FF9966.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#EC864E is #E85. The Closest Color to #EC864E is #FF7F50. Official Name of #EC864E Hex Code is Tan Hide.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#EC864E is 0 Cyan 43 Magenta 67 Yellow 7 Black and #EC864E CMY is 0, 43, 67.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#EC864E is hsl(21,81,62,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(21, 67, 93).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#EC864E is 44.5, 35.44, 11.7.
Hex8 Value of #EC864E is #EC864EFF. Decimal Value of #EC864E is 15500878 and Octal Value of #EC864E is 73103116. Binary Value of #EC864E is 11101100, 10000110, 1001110 and Android of #EC864E is 4293690958 / 0xffec864e.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#EC864E is 0.486, 0.387, 0.387 and YIQ Color Space of #EC864E is 158.114, 78.7746, 4.1458.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#EC864E is 45.93, 28.92, 12.12.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#EC864E is 66.09, 34.41, 46.45.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#EC864E is 66.09, 80.24, 45.97.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#EC864E is 66.09, 57.81, 53.47. Hunter Lab variable of #EC864E is 59.53, 29.25, 30.02.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#EC864E

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
